Beyhive Buzzing Over Beyoncé's Miami Concert

MIAMI (CBSMiami) – Queen Bey hit center stage at Marlins Park Wednesday night to a home run.

Beyoncé was in town for the opening of her new Formation World Tour and a new album to thrilled Miami fans.

Before the show started, formation and fashion went hand in hand. Thousands of fans known as the Beyhive came dressed to impress to see their number one superstar.

"Honestly, I think this is most intimate she has ever come out with her fans," said one fan. "This album is crazy. It just came out and I think it's going to be huge considering we are the first concert of this tour. I'm just way too excited for this."

Beyoncé released "Lemonade" on Saturday night. It's a visual album that dropped a media bombshell, which left fans wondering if her husband of 8 years, Jay Z, had an affair.

Most of the fans CBS4's Lisa Petrillo spoke with understood this album is where artistry meets business.

"She's just talented. She's trained, she's well trained. She's driven and she's a hell of a marketer," a fan said.

Another fan said, "I don't think that Beyoncé is being cheated on by Jay Z, I think she just did it for us think that."

But not all agreed.

"I'm very upset with Jay Z. If I was to see him right now, I gonna be like, 'Oh my God.' I would sting him with Beyhive eyes," a fan said.

But no stinging here, just honey for a superstar who completely connects with fans.
